According with its conservation philosophy, El Remanso Lodge has been developing projects in order to help preserving our rainforest, which is so rich down here in the Osa Peninsula. What can be better than a tree nursery? Our tree nursery has been running for more than ten years and in this small scale “vivero” (green house) we collect, germinate, replant and donate saplings from different native species of the Osa.

Every little town in Costa Rica has its annual “fiestas” for a week long celebration with events such as parades, rodeos with bulls and other cultural expressions. Last week we had the “Fiestas de San Juan Bautista” here in Puerto Jiménez on the Osa Peninsula and on Sunday afternoon part of the El Remanso team went to the final parade. Our intern Kris took his camera to captures some of the moments. There were many different activities with parades, local dances and a horse-ride of over 50 riders from Puerto Jiménez toward the Matapalo area.
On June 23rd, El Remanso's staff had the initiative of doing a Beach Clean-Up from the Tide Pools to the Lagoon! Where does the garbage come from? The beach below El Remanso is certainly an astonishing, beautiful & deserted beach, however even a remote place like this gets its share of pollution. Mostly plastic bottles brought by the tide land unfortunately on the beaches of this paradise of the Osa Peninsula. After a few hours work, and thanks to the volunteers, the beach of El Remanso is not only amazingly beautiful but super clean too!

There are 6 different venomous snakes in the Osa Peninsula. One of which, the Eyelash Pitviper (bothriechis schlegelii) is a medium size, venomous snake with mostly arboreal habits, which makes this a far less frequently spotted snake than other ones. One of the most striking features of this pitviper is the presence of two, eyelash like pointed scales above each eye. This snake has several different dimorphism (a wide array of color variations): there is the green one (the most common) but they can also be brown, gray and the most spectacular one is golden!
It's running time down here in the Osa Peninsula! This year's Lapathon fundraiser race took place yesterday, Sunday 5th of May, with the objective of raising funds for the recreational sport center in Puerto Jiménez. El Remanso participated in the organization and a good part of our team run the race! The race started at the local carbonera school, about 5km away from the lodge and ended in Puerto Jiménez. The runners had to cover a distance of 17km on the gravel road. Fortunately the weather was "good to everyone" and it did not rain at all during the race!
